0687703
No reviews have been written for this product.
Description
MEPRO 0687703MOR PRO 2.2 MOA DOR/RED LASER/IR
Categories:
Optics
Condition:
New
SKU:
GF-810013520439
MPN:
0687703
UPC:
810013520439
Vendor:
gunprime feed
Related Items
Popular Items
Reviews
(0)